Wow, it is 2024 already. Can you believe it?! I want to take this opportunity to share a look ahead at our USTA St. Louis goals for this year. Our mission — and main goal — is always to grow tennis. We must continue to find new and innovative ways to ensure tennis is accessible to all.

 

Key Goals for 2024:

 

• Support any and all initiatives to revitalize existing courts as well as projects to build new courts.

 

• Increase court access for adaptive tennis.

 

• Expand our local officiating staff; develop a supporting court monitor program.
